Fonts
These functions let you get into the nitty-gritty of fonts. Where licensing permits, you can embed entire fonts or subsets, or find out font properties like name, size, width, height, descent, kerning info, and so on…
AddCJKFontAddFormFont
AddOpenTypeFontFromFile
AddOpenTypeFontFromString
AddOpenTypeFontFromVariant
AddStandardFont
AddSubsettedFont
AddToUnicodeFontGroup
AddTrueTypeFont
AddTrueTypeFontFromFile
AddTrueTypeFontFromFileEx
AddTrueTypeFontFromString
AddTrueTypeFontFromStringEx
AddTrueTypeFontFromVariant
AddTrueTypeFontFromVariantEx
AddTrueTypeSubsettedFont
AddTrueTypeSubsettedFontFromFile
AddTrueTypeSubsettedFontFromString
AddTrueTypeSubsettedFontFromVariant
AddType1Font
AddUnicodeFont
AddUnicodeFontFromFile
CharWidth
CompressFonts
DAGetTextBlockCharWidth
DAGetTextBlockFontName
DAGetTextBlockFontSize
FindFonts
FontCount
FontFamily
FontHasKerning
FontName
FontReference
FontSize
FontType
GetFontCharacterCodesToString
GetFontCharacterCodesToVariant
GetFontEncoding
GetFontFlags
GetFontID
GetFontIsEmbedded
GetFontIsSubsetted
GetFontMetrics
GetFontObjectNumber
GetFormFontCount
GetFormFontName
GetInstalledFontsByCharset
GetInstalledFontsByCodePage
GetKerning
GetTextAscent
GetTextBlockBound
GetTextBlockCharWidth
GetTextBlockFontName
GetTextBlockFontSize
GetTextBound
GetTextDescent
GetTextHeight
GetTextSize
GetTextWidth
GetUnicodeCharactersFromEncoding
HasFontResources
NoEmbedFontListAdd
NoEmbedFontListCount
NoEmbedFontListGet
NoEmbedFontListRemoveAll
NoEmbedFontListRemoveIndex
NoEmbedFontListRemoveName
ReplaceFonts
SaveFontToFile
SelectFont
SelectedFont
SetFontEncoding
SetFontFlags
SetFormFieldStandardFont
SetKerning
UpdateTrueTypeSubsettedFont
UseKerning